The IT Digital Transformation Manager is responsible for leading and executing the organization's digital transformation initiatives by leveraging modern full-stack technologies and AI-driven solutions. This role bridges business strategy and technology execution, ensuring digital platforms, applications, and processes are scalable, secure, and aligned with organizational goals.
The position requires hands-on development experience, strong architectural skills, and the ability to lead cross-functional teams in delivering innovative digital solutions.
Key Responsibilities
Digital Transformation Leadership
- Lead the planning and execution of digital transformation programs aligned with business objectives
- Identify opportunities to automate, digitize, and optimize business processes using modern technologies
- Collaborate with business units to translate operational needs into technical solutions
Solution Architecture & Development
- Design and oversee end-to-end digital solutions using full-stack architectures
- Ensure systems are scalable, secure, and compliant with industry and regulatory standards
- Review and approve technical designs, coding standards, and development best practices
Full-Stack Development Oversight
- Provide hands-on guidance and code reviews for front-end and back-end development
- Support development using modern frameworks and platforms (web, mobile, and APIs)
- Ensure seamless integration between applications, databases, and third-party systems
AI & Emerging Technologies
- Lead adoption of AI tools such as machine learning models, chatbots, RPA, analytics, and intelligent automation
- Identify use cases for AI to improve customer experience, risk management, and operational efficiency
- Ensure responsible and secure use of AI technologies
Team & Vendor Management
- Lead and mentor developers, analysts, and technical staff
- Manage external vendors, consultants, and technology partners
- Monitor project timelines, budgets, and deliverables
Governance, Security & Compliance
- Ensure IT solutions comply with cybersecurity policies, data privacy laws, and regulatory requirements
- Implement DevSecOps and best practices for secure development and deployment
- Maintain proper documentation and audit readiness
